About uBlock
uBlock Origin is a CPU and memory efficient, wide spectrum content blocker for Chromium and Firefox, aimed at anyone who wants ads, trackers, coin miners, popups, anti blockers and malware sites neutralised by default without hand tuning anything.

About maxurl
English Português (Brasil) Image Max URL is a program that will try to find larger/original versions of images and videos, usually by replacing URL patterns. It currently contains support for \ 10,000 hardcoded websites (full list in sites.txt), but it also supports a number of generic engines (such as Wordpress and MediaWiki), which means it can work for many other websites as well. It is currently released as: Userscript: (most browsers) Stable: userscript smaller.user.js or OpenUserJS Development: userscript.user.js (recommended) It serves as the base for everything listed below.
